How they compare

Suriname currently reports 4.0% against 3.9% in Haiti, a difference of 0.1%.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 7 shared years of data; in 1973 it was Suriname ahead.

Haiti ranks 78th and Suriname ranks 77th of 194 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Haiti averaged higher in 1 and Suriname in 2.

Head to head by decade

Decade Haiti Suriname Difference Ahead
1970s 11.3% 86.0% 74.7% Suriname
1990s 0.1% 72.5% 72.4% Suriname
2010s 6.7% 0.2% 6.4% Haiti

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Ores and metals comprise the commodities in SITC (Rev. 3) sections 27 (crude fertilizer, minerals nes); 28 (metalliferous ores, scrap); and 68 (non-ferrous metals). Exports of services are services provided by residents to non-residents. This indicator is expressed as a percentage of merchandise exports which is comprised of goods whose economic ownership is changed between a resident and a non-resident and that are not included in the following specific categories: goods under merchanting, non-monetary gold, and parts of travel, construction, and government goods and services n.i.e.
